Incident Overview

This is the FINAL update for the Coffman and Chestnut Ridge Fires in the Valley Complex.

These fires were managed under a Unified Commmand by the U.S. Forest Service, National Park Service, Virginia Department of Forestry, Rockingham County Fire & Rescue (only fires in Rockingham County).


Basic Information

Incident TypeWildfire
CauseCoffman - Power Line, Chestnut Ridge - Cause Unknown
Date of OriginSaturday February 19th, 2011 approx. 12:00 AM
Location10 miles W. of Harrisonburg, Va; N of Hwy 33; W of SR 612.
Incident CommanderWilder; Thomas; Symons

Current Situation

Size3,479 acres
Percent Contained100%
Estimated Containment DateThursday March 10th, 2011 approx. 12:00 AM
